Cardano Building Toward Key Resistance
The ADA price has broken above the declining channel line, now trading around the $0.88 zone and exhibiting renewed strength. The ADA price is holding above the $0.875 support zone, with buyers entering in after hitting lows of $0.857. A close above the $0.89-$0.90 range could start a rally toward $0.96 and $1.02 for the ADA price.
If Cardano clears the $1.00 mark, momentum might extend beyond $1.17, while failure to hold above key moving averages may drive the ADA price back below channel support. With a probable cup and handle forming, the ADA price might soon approach the $1.00 psychological level if the bullish breakout is confirmed.
Chainlink Setting Up for the Next Rally
The Chainlink price is consolidating near the $23.9 resistance zone after breaking over a continuation triangle, showing strong bullish momentum. Buyers earlier defended the support line and imbalance zone, exhibiting firm demand. If bullish momentum sustains, Chainlink might climb toward the $26–$27 zone, with a potential extension toward the $40 goal.
